Designed for modern brides who love timeless romance, this hand-tied bouquet features dreamy white lilium, white-purple lisianthus, striking purple veronica, delicate gypsophila and lush aralia leaves. The soft whites and purples create a sophisticated, romantic look that complements classic, contemporary or boho bridal styles.
